In the world of theater, accessories are often used to help define characters and convey their personalities. A prop like a hat or a cane can instantly transform a performer into a different time period or social class. Similarly, a piece of jewelry or a specific hairstyle can help to establish the cultural background or social status of a character.

In dance performances, accessories can add an extra layer of visual interest and movement. For example, a flowing scarf or a pair of gloves can enhance the graceful movements of a dancer, while a belt or sash can emphasize the hip movements in a Latin dance routine. Accessories can also help to distinguish different dancers or groups within a performance, making it easier for the audience to follow the choreography.

In music performances, accessories can play a practical as well as a symbolic role. Instruments are, of course, a vital accessory for musicians, but other items like hats, sunglasses, or even a signature piece of jewelry can help to create a distinct image for the performer. These accessories can become part of the artist’s personal brand, helping them to stand out in a crowded industry.

### FAQs

**Q: Are there any rules or guidelines for choosing accessories for a stage performance?**
A: While there are no hard and fast rules, it’s essential to consider the character, setting, and mood of the performance when selecting accessories. It’s also crucial to ensure that the accessories enhance the overall look of the performer without overpowering them.

**Q: How can accessories help performers connect with their characters?**
A: Accessories can serve as a physical connection to a character, helping the performer to embody their personality and emotions more fully. For example, a specific piece of jewelry or a prop can trigger associations and memories that inform the performer’s portrayal.

**Q: What should performers keep in mind when using accessories in a stage performance?**
A: Performers should make sure that their accessories are securely attached and comfortable to wear, as they will be moving and performing on stage. It’s also essential to practice with the accessories beforehand to ensure that they work well with the choreography and do not impede movement.

**Q: Can accessories be used to differentiate between different characters or groups in a performance?**
A: Yes, accessories can be a valuable tool for distinguishing between characters or groups in a performance. By using different colors, styles, or types of accessories, performers can make it easier for the audience to follow the action and understand the relationships between characters.
